Abstract: | Binary ionogenic equilibria (RX + MtXx ? R+MtXn + l? ? R+ + MtXn + 1?, R = φ3C, (pClC6H4)3C; X = Cl; Mt = Hg) are studied in CH2Cl2 by conductivity and u.v. spectroscopy. The importance of such studies to cationic polymerisation is emphasised. The equilibrium constants, the thermodynamic parameters and the molar conductivities of the individual ions are given and the results discussed both in terms of a comparison between the two systems studied and in terms of a comparison with similar data in the literature. |
